6. Take Tyrosine Supplements

Tyrosine assists the brain in producing important chemicals that aid in nerve cell communication. This amino acid is vital for increasing energy levels and mood. It is present in many foods that are high in protein, such as meat and nuts.

Research suggests that tyrosine may improve mental performance in stressful situations and help improve memory. It may also increase alertness in those who have lost their sleep.

Initial research suggests that tyrosine could reduce depression symptoms. However, it doesn't seem to boost exercise performance or heart rates when taken before a cycle test. It doesn't appear to improve attention disorder (ADD) or childhood ADHD. Magnesium is an essential nutrient that helps your body utilize energy and keep your body in good shape, maintain normal nerve and muscle function and ensure that your bones are strong. It is also involved in the regulation of other hormones, neurotransmitters, and neurotransmitters such as serotonin. In previous clinical studies the consumption of magnesium was associated with a lower chance of developing depression.

general-medical-council-logo.pngNational dietary surveys consistently show that most people don't get enough magnesium. This may be due to aging, which lowers magnesium absorption and boosts the excretion in urine and eating a diet that is low in magnesium-rich food items and the use of medications that affect the body's ability to absorb and retain the mineral.

One one ounce of pumpkin seeds offers 156 milligrams of magnesium which is 37% of the Daily Value. Chia seeds are also a superfood, offering antioxidants, omega-3 fatty acid, calcium, and fiber.
